Fimbo takes on Magicians today Friday, 11th April, as both franchises seek better reputation and 2 million Uganda Shillings prize, the 3rd ranked franchise earns in the Protector Rugby Super Series.

Magicians find themselves in this situation, having failed to upstage Crocs last weekend, who beat them 16:25, to losing second place on the table log of the series.

Along with the loss came another, which was an opportunity to feature as team in the Bamburi Rugby Super Series.

Magicians who comprise Mongers, Stallions, Buffaloes and Heathens league players will now embark on defeating Fimbo this friday, the only team they have beaten in this competition.

Magicians’ coach Brian Tindimweba, however faces a daunting task, despite their 08-03 victory the first battle against fast improving Fimbo.

Coach Sam Ahamya’s Fimbo franchise which is made up of Pirates and Rhinos players also seek their first series victory, having lost twice, drawing 20:20 against Protectors last weekend.

Fimbo are expected to mainly rely on lock Ivan Wavamuno, Byron Atubikire, Ronald Adigasi, Isaac Rujumba, Brian Jjemba and Chonga Gordon while Magicians may capitalize on the stength of last weekend’s penalty scorer Joseph Oyet, Tonny Luggya and Kenneth Opita.

Friday 11th April Fixtures at Kyadondo Rugby Grounds

FIMBO Vs MAGICIANS at 5:00pm
